405. To ask the Minister for Health given that the HSE has yet to provide dedicated mental health support to families affected by the unnecessary DHH surgeries and, in the interim, the HSE has advised the relevant advocacy group that medical card holders may seek a referral through their GP, if she can provide an update on how much longer affected families will have to wait for this support; when the necessary funding will be approved to ensure the provision of this much needed mental health service;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[52645/25]
